The 6cm strip makes it easier to use on two patients or cases. Once you open and cut the strip, you may store the unused part for up to 4 weeks in a Light Protection Box in a fridge. The Light Protection Box is available here.

Type of fibers: E-glass
Fiber orientation: Multidirectional (Braided)
Strip dimensions: 3mm x 0.3mm x 60 mm (width x thickness x length)
Applications: Bridge frameworks, which due to enhanced pliability, are especially useful in anterior temporaries with different retentions (wing- Maryland, slot, inlay etc.)
Light save box: Included with purchases of min. 3 strips

About the product:
Dentapreg® PFM is a strong, prefabricated, light curing resin impregnated strip with enhanced pliability for anterior bridge framework fabrication. Dentapreg® PFM offers good pliability, unsurpassed esthetics, superior performance and excellent bonding to teeth and restorative composites. Dentapreg® can be used in direct chair side procedures as well as in indirect laboratory procedures.


Dentapreg® is a constructive composite, a new class of composite suitable for building structures such as dental splints, temporary bridges and large restorations. Dentapreg® is delivered in the form of sticky pliable glass fiber strips pre-impregnated with the light curing resin. When cured, this strip becomes rigid. The other form of Dentapreg® is tiny flexible glass fiber pin which is suitable for building minimally invasive retention of crown (endo-posts, parapulpal posts).

Working with Dentapreg® is simple, fast and safe. No special instruments or materials are required.

Dental splints, temporary bridges, endo-posts and other devices built from Dentapreg® are reliable and esthetically beautiful.
